3-Way Calling Feature Instructions
To Initiate 3-Way Calling:
- While on the first call, dial the 10-digit number of the second person.
- Press SEND. The first person is automatically put on hold while the call is made.
- When the second person answers, press SEND to create a conference call.
- If the second person does not answer, press the SEND key twice to end the connection and go back to the first person.
- To end both conversations completely, press the END key.
To Initiate 3-Way Calling with PIN:
- Press CLEAR.
- Dial the second person's 10-digit telephone number.
- Press SEND.
- Enter the PIN.
- Press SEND, and then press SEND again to connect all three people once the party has answered.

To Initiate Call Waiting:
When you're on the line and a second call comes in, you'll hear a tone to let you know you have another call. When that happens, you have three choices:
- Put the first call on hold by pressing SEND. You'll automatically be connected with the second call. To return to the first call: Press SEND again. To switch between the two calls, press SEND.
OR - End the first call by asking the first caller to hang up. This automatically connects you to your waiting call.
OR - Ignore the Call Waiting tone. After 30 seconds, the waiting caller will hear a message indicating that you're not available, or will be forwarded to your voice mailbox if you subscribe to a messaging service.
To Cancel Call Waiting:
Before a call, press *70 + the 10 digit number you are calling + SEND.

This feature is also known as "Immediate Call Forwarding".
Call Forwarding Feature Instructions
To Activate:
- Press *72.
- Enter the phone number where you want calls to be forwarded. (e.g. *72-908-123-4567).
- Press SEND and wait for confirmation. You should hear a confirmation tone or a message "Your feature has been activated".
- Press END.
To Deactivate:
- Press *73.
- Press SEND and wait for confirmation. You should hear a confirmation tone or a message "Your feature has been de-activated".
- Press END.

No Answer/Busy Transfer Feature Instructions
To Activate No Answer / Busy Transfer:
- Press *71 and the 10-digit number you want the calls forwarded to.
- Press the SEND key and wait for the confirmation tone.
To Deactivate No Answer / Busy Transfer:
- Press *73 SEND and wait for the confirmation tone.
Outbound calls can still be made while No Answer/Busy Transfer is activated. When activated, an incoming call will ring several times, giving you the chance to answer the call. If you are on the phone or choose not to answer, the incoming call will be automatically forwarded to the destination phone number.

To place a call outside of the US, you must start with 011. Next, you must use the country code, and then the number you wish to reach. You can find a list of country codes on the International Dialing page.
For example, if you would like to call a number in France, first use 011, then the country code 33, then you enter the phone number and then press SEND.
